Transaction 0efa95762602fa2f224c79c5e26a8043c3d437fc61811e008c6846805c6764c9
1 Input
1 Output
-
0efa95762602fa2f224c79c5e26a8043c3d437fc61811e008c6846805c6764c9:0
- value
- 18403238
- script pubkey
- OP_0 OP_PUSHBYTES_20 311a2c9a6d2c978a12daf42aad13cc940844beeb
- address
- bc1qxydzexnd9jtc5yk67s426y7vjsyyf0ht3wsj64